Data Transfer Speed Expectations

I remind myself that an adapter cannot magically make a USB 2.0 device run at USB 3.0 speeds. If the device is USB 2.0, it will still operate at USB 2.0 performance. What I do expect is smooth compatibility and stable connection. If I need faster speeds, I make sure the device itself supports USB 3.0.

I think a USB 2.0 to 3.0 adapter can be a simple and practical way to improve compatibility between older devices and newer ports. My main takeaway is that it helps with convenience and connectivity, but it won’t magically make USB 2.0 devices run at USB 3.0 speeds. If I want the best performance, I still need to make sure the device itself supports faster transfer rates.
